		<description>An Affiliate Random Ad Rotating WordPress Plugin is now running on my funny jokes site at http://www.free-funny-jokes.com/

It was surprisingly difficult to find a WordPress plugin that could be used to rotate ads via a MYSQL database (didn&#039;t want to use text files). I tried over a dozen scripts (not all WordPress plugins) and none of them came close to what I wanted!!!

Eventually found a WordPress plugin called &quot;Nice Quotes Rotator&quot; which was created to add rotating quotes to WordPress blogs, it was apparently inspired by the Hello Dolly plugin that comes with WordPress by default.

Since I was looking to create an affiliate random ad rotating plugin for the jokes site it needed a fair amount of code changes.

After editing the plugin to work as I wanted, downloaded a CSV format Shareasale datafeed that was for an affiliate that offers stupid prank gifts.

Downloaded and partially renamed the images (for SEO reasons) associated with the datafeed, using MS Excel took the name of each product and added Stupid Prank Gifts to the end of it (for SEO and marketing reasons).

Used some nifty javascript/CSS coding so the affiliate links won&#039;t be recognised by Google etc... as links (mo wasted PR/link benefit), but Google can still get to the name of the product and the image that&#039;s uploaded onto my server so potential to gain some prank related SERPs.

Edited my Talian 05 theme (that was pretty easy to do) to use a WordPress shortcode for the new plugin to generate several ads: what you see when you visit the jokes site.

Pretty cool result if I do say so myself :-)

Will be interesting to see how much money it makes, before today had Chitika ads running on the site and their performance was RUBBISH: last 30 days just $76.69 from 1,087,247 impressions (I think Chitika reports an impression each ad loaded, I had two ad units per page so that&#039;s from half a million page loads!).

If I can&#039;t make more than $76 a month from half a million page loads linked to an affiliate I give up!

		<description>My funny jokes site is now breaking 15,000 unique visitors a day, so time I did something to make some money from the site (10K visitors a day wasn&#039;t enough to get me moving apparently :-)).

Interestingly the top traffic SERP is now Funny Jokes, not bad for number 5 in Google for that SERP (that&#039;s a lot of traffic for that SERP to do well at number 5).

I&#039;ve found a pranks product affiliate that offers a reasonable % and a datafeed, plan to use the datafeed to create my own ad system that runs as a replacement to the ad system I&#039;ve added to my Talian 05 theme (replace AdSense/Clickbank).

Basically will generate ads with X number of products on the sidebar and a single product on the main content ad unit, will have a small thumbnail of each product and excerpt type description (maybe just the title of the product + price) all linking to the affiliate sales page.

Was going to use a random quotes script as a starting point, but all the ones I&#039;ve downloaded (half a dozen) aren&#039;t working in PHP 5! Come to think of it, why didn&#039;t I just search for a PHP script that serves ads :-) I was also looking for a quotes script to add an automated joke a day section to the site, looks like I got caught up on one solution for both problems!

		<description>I hear ya... I have the same issue. I have a similar(kinda) maybe a bit more offensive site that gets almost 1 million page views monthly. Been very hard to make money on. Clicksor did not work due to viruses and malware and everything else had horrid ctr. The only thing that seems to work is sex and dating (generates a few hundred on a small ad).

Guess people looking for tasteless stuff are alone... go figure. I kinda gave up on ever making great money off it. My more mainstream sites make thousands monthly off a fraction of the traffic.

The other thing that would work is the schemes and scams, penny auctions, work at home, etc. I will not use those because I like to sleep at night, but others have no issue and it does work with that type of traffic. Also try lead gen. Add a email squeeze as a flash ad or HTML of some kind. Those actually do well when you offer up something they want in the end and you can sell the leads, have them go to a affiliate program or use them yourself to promote other sites.

What I know for a fact is that products do not work well. That type of traffic does not want to spend any money so look for &quot;free&quot; offers, surveys, what not. CJ, Clickbank, etc. have tons.

		<description>That&#039;s some serious traffic you have David and I&#039;m not sure if you&#039;ve considered any of the following.

1. With such a massive audience I&#039;d pay to have a simple iPhones App created that has the Top 100 jokes. You could do this for several categories. And charge $1 per download or 50c. Might be cheap enough to encourage $20-$30/day or more ;o)

2. Or another option is to encourage people to have a tee-shirt printed with a funny joke. You could get the top 5 jokes from each category and use a service like cafepress.com or fibres.com to let people buy the T-shirt.

3. Another option is to put together a Free PDF with the top 100 Jokes. And within the PDF have a few affiliate links to some of the online Joke Shops.

Some food for thought.</description>

		<description>I took a look at your jokes forum post (you have to register on the forum to read it BTW).

The responses don&#039;t give any solutions per se, but does sum up the problem, humor/joke sites suck for making money! You don&#039;t go to a joke site to buy a product or find a solution to a problem etc... you visit to have a laugh or kill time while bored at work. On my jokes site most of the visitors are looking for racist jokes and those who comment (3,000+ comments on one jokes page for example) are mostly trashing one another!!!

When I had AdSense on the joke site (before the AdSense ban) it averaged around £1 (~$1.50) eCPM (effective cost per thousand impressions). In comparison my sites about making money have eCPMs of over £6 and my SEO sites around £5. I have another site about classic literature that received around 2,000,000 impressions last year and it&#039;s eCPM is even lower that the jokes site, so it could be worse :-) 

I&#039;m thinking about adding links to affiliates that sell prank products, but I&#039;m not expecting many sales despite regularly breaking 10,000 unique visitors a day, so no rush.
